radeon/llvm: Fix VTX_READ patterns

The VTX_READ instructions were using the ADDRParam ComplexPattern which
allows a load instruction's offset to be a register, but VTX_READ
instructions can only handle an immediate offset.

Also, the load_param pattern fragment had an erroneous return true;
statement that was causing it to match the wrong load instructions.
